Forbes: Luke Bryan Is Highest-Paid Country Star

Luke Bryan is ringing the register.

(Undated)  --  "Forbes" is out with its list of the highest-paid country stars. 

Luke Bryan takes the top spot with an income of about 52-million dollars. 

His "American Idol" gig and endorsement deal with Chevy helped him to dethrone country music icon Garth Brooks, who's now in second place. 

Kenny Chesney is in third place, followed by the Zac Brown Band in fourth and Blake Shelton rounding out the top five.
